WebA determiner is a word used to modify a noun by letting the reader know more about that noun. A list of determiners would include articles, possessives, demonstratives, quantifiers, question words and even numbers. WebA determiner is a word that specifies a noun by giving more information about its location, quantity, or ownership. Determiners require a noun to go alongside them; they can't … Web27 apr. 2014 · It's a separate part, in English. The determiner(s), which can be quite complex, must come before the adjective(s) in a noun phrase. In the noun phrase [[more than 300 of the] [wild, undisciplined, and drunk] cowboys] the first bracketed phrase constitutes the quantifier(s), and the second the adjective(s). Both modify the head noun …

WebThe determiner NO means ~ not one; not any; not a – NO is used with a noun “The sign says no dogs allowed.” (Not one dog/not any dog is allowed here.The noun dogs follows the determiner NO.) The pronoun NONE means ~ not one of a group of people or things; not any – NONE is used without a noun “The donuts were gone when I got to work this …
